Note: 1. Examination in each subject will be of 3 hours duration.

2. Maximum marks for external/written examination is 70 marks and internal assessment is 30


marks except for seminar and workshop courses.

Instructions to the Paper Setters:

Set 10 questions in all. Two or Three questions from each unit. The students are required to answer five
questions in all selecting at least one question from each unit.

Use of non-programmable calculators by the students in the Examination Hall is allowed. The calculators
will not be provided by the University.

Minimum five students must be there to start any elective group.


After third semester student will undertake a 16 weeks On-the-Job Training.
